Programming in Assembly Is Brutal, Beautiful, and Maybe Even a Path to Better AI

The article discusses the challenges and potential benefits of programming in assembly language, a low-level programming language that directly interacts with a computer's hardware. It highlights the brutal nature of assembly programming, which requires a deep understanding of the underlying hardware and can be significantly more complex than higher-level languages. However, the article also acknowledges the beauty and precision of assembly programming, as it allows developers to have more control and optimization over their code. The article suggests that the skills acquired through assembly programming may even be a path to better AI systems. By understanding the fundamental principles of how a computer's hardware operates, developers could potentially create more efficient and effective AI algorithms. The article emphasizes that while assembly programming is a demanding and often daunting task, it can provide valuable insights and skills that may contribute to the advancement of technology, including the field of artificial intelligence.
